You can run the RCD330+ most definitely!
I just got mine in and it took about one beer plus a half to get the stock Premium setup out and the RCD 330 + put in.
Now we have Apple Carplay/Android Auto and it works flawlessly.
Two things we lost (actually 3) was the CD changer, XM radio, and AM radio (bummer).
We have always wanted to stream things but didnt want a different head unit like a pioneer.
The RCD330 is from other markets across the globe so the AM stepping is not similar to the US. However, you can always stream your station if you have an app for it.
Being able to have a color touch screen, PHONE works great, etc.....it was a no brainer for us.
To keep the functionality in the Mk V (ours is a 2005.5) we needed a canbus simulator that is essentially an extension cord for the stock input and is a must have to keep the buttons working and the "potential" battery drain I learned about.
Aux input is on the front of the RCD headunit as well as inputs for USB and SD card.
